The size of Mcleods Shoot is approximately 6.6 square kilometres. The population of Mcleods Shoot in 2016 was 102 people. By 2021 the population was 113 showing a population growth of 10.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Mcleods Shoot is 10-19 years. Households in Mcleods Shoot are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Mcleods Shoot work in a managers occupation.In 2021, 89.60% of the homes in Mcleods Shoot were owner-occupied compared with 66.70% in 2016.
